How to Cast a Bullet: Free Online Guide to Making Your Own Ammunition
The term bullet is often mistakenly used to describe a round of ammunition as a whole, but in fact the actual bullet is only one component of the cartridge. The bullet is the metal projectile, usually made of lead, at the end of the round. It is sometimes referred to as a slug. While the vast majority of ammunition is manufactured in factories, many people choose to make their own. Casting your own ammunition has long been a tradition practiced by hunters and gamekeepers, and it s a great way to save money.
